## India E-Rickshaw Market Size(in USD Mn), 2017-2023

The E-Rickshaw Market in India witnessed significant growth during 2017–2023, registering a strong CAGR of 48.6%. The market expanded from USD 81.2 million in 2017 to USD 875.7 million in 2023, reflecting an increase of more than ten times, although it faced disruption during the pandemic in 2020. This sharp rise can be attributed to the government’s growing focus on green energy, job losses during COVID that pushed many individuals to seek alternative livelihood opportunities, infrastructure development through improved road connectivity, and the increasing need for last-mile transportation. Since the pandemic, the market has continued to grow consistently, and this momentum is expected to carry forward into the future period.

## India E-Rickshaw Market Segmentation, 2023

### India E-Rickshaw Market by End User (in revenue %), 2023

E-rickshaws used for passenger transport, particularly for last-mile connectivity, contributed to more than 90% of the overall revenue generated by manufacturers. Although the growth rate of e-rickshaws used for carrying goods has been higher than that of passenger e-rickshaws, its market share has remained marginal in comparison, accounting for around 9%. These contrasting trends can be explained by the earning opportunities available in the two segments. Passenger carriers can begin generating income immediately by serving last-mile mobility needs, whereas goods carriers must first find suitable transport opportunities. In addition, heavy motor vehicles are still more commonly preferred for the secure transportation of goods, and e-rickshaws may not be practical for long-distance movement.

### India E-Rickshaw Market by regional segmentation (in USD Mn), 2023

The highlighted states together account for around 60% of the total e-rickshaw concentration in India, with most of them located in Northern India, where inadequate public transportation infrastructure has created strong demand for last-mile connectivity solutions. In addition, rising demand from Tier-2 and Tier-3 cities is further pushing adoption higher and is expected to contribute to the increase in e-rickshaw numbers during the forecast period. Among these states, Uttar Pradesh dominates the e-rickshaw market landscape with a 42.7% share. This can be attributed to the state’s large population centers, which create strong demand-side support, along with government incentives and subsidies that encourage e-rickshaw adoption, such as the provision of public charging stations by the Noida Metro Rail Corporation, which strengthens the supply side as well.

### India E-Rickshaw Market by Battery type (in revenue %), 2023

Lead acid batteries dominate the Indian e-rickshaw market with a 53.7% share, primarily because they are easily accessible and available at a lower cost compared to alternatives such as lithium-ion batteries. Lithium-ion batteries, on the other hand, offer faster charging capabilities than lead-acid batteries, and their lightweight nature makes them particularly important for electric vehicles such as scooters, rickshaws, and carts. At present, lithium-ion batteries account for the remaining 46.3% share of the Indian e-rickshaw market.

## India E-Rickshaw Market Industry Analysis

### India E-Rickshaw Market Growth Drivers

**Government Support**

The Indian government has introduced subsidies and incentives to encourage the adoption of e-rickshaws. FAME (Faster Adoption and Manufacturing of Hybrid and Electric Vehicles) India Scheme: Offers incentives to purchasers of electric vehicles, including e-rickshaws, by providing an initial reduction in the buying cost. Subsidies: Offered by state governments, such as Delhi, which provides subsidies of up to INR 30,000 for e-rickshaws Public Charging Stations: Setting up charging stations for e-rickshaws, akin to the initiatives proposed by the Noida Metro Rail Corporation. Waiver of Registration Fees and Road Tax: Some state governments grant exemptions on registration fees and road taxes for e-rickshaws. For example, the Uttar Pradesh government has mandated a complete waiver of road tax and registration fees for e-rickshaws acquired from October 14, 2022, to October 13, 2025.

**Low operational costs**

E-rickshaws have lower maintenance and fuel costs compared to traditional auto-rickshaws, making them more cost-effective. Firstly, e-rickshaws are battery-operated and do not require fuel, which is a recurring cost in traditional ICE-based three-wheelers. Implying that hat e-rickshaws escape the recurring cost of fuel that is required in ICE-based three-wheelers, making them cheaper to operate.

**Less expensive than Conventional 3 wheelers**

The expense associated with acquiring an e-rickshaw is significantly lower when compared to procuring an ICE-based three-wheeler. For Instance, cost of an e-rickshaw is around INR 1.5 lakh, whereas an ICE-based three-wheeler can reach up to INR 3.5 lakh.

**Rapid urbanization**

According to World Bank, the urban population in India was 34% in 2017, and it is expected to reach 40.76% by 2030. Hence, India's rapid urbanization has led to increased demand for efficient and affordable transportation solutions, which e-rickshaws provide.

### India E-Rickshaw Market Challenges

**Horizontal manufacturing structure**

The e-rickshaw industry in India is characterized by a horizontal manufacturing structure and poses several disadvantages. Some manufacturers function as assemblers, obtaining components such as motors and controllers at the most economical prices, often compromising the quality of the drive train. This leads to an increase in maintenance cost due to subpar parts.

**Carrying excessive weight**

Carrying more passengers than the legal maximum of four is widespread, exacerbating wear and tear, which shortens the vehicle's lifespan by impacting both the motor and the battery, whether lead-acid or Li-ion.

**High battery replacement costs**

The replacement cost of batteries is around INR 25,000-28,000, which may make e-rickshaw owners turn to suppliers for returns. Which accounts for over 20% of the average cost of an E-Rickshaw.

## India E-Rickshaw Future Market Size

### India E-Rickshaw Future Market Size (in USD Mn), 2023-2029

The E-Rickshaw Market is anticipated to grow at a CAGR of 25.1%, expanding from USD 875.7 million in 2023 to USD 3,359.7 million by 2029. This growth is primarily driven by the increasing focus on raising the share of electric vehicles compared to fuel-based vehicles such as diesel and petrol models, in line with India’s progress toward its 2070 net-zero target. In this context, the government has introduced schemes such as FAME, with its second phase already underway, to support EV adoption. In addition, state governments have been proactive in encouraging electric vehicle usage, particularly for last-mile connectivity, in order to reduce dependence on conventional fuel vehicles.
